摘要
Comprehensive Summary At present, in order to overcome electromagnetic interference and prevent electromagnetic harm, the research of new and efficient electromagnetic wave absorbing materials has become the research focus in the field of materials science. The one‐dimensional structure can promote the impedance matching and attenuation characteristics of the absorbing materials. Electrospinning, as an effective method to prepare nanofibers with high length‐diameter ratio, has been widely concerned because it is suitable for structural design of various materials. In this paper, the research progress and absorption properties of nano‐fiber materials prepared by electrospinning combined with different processes are introduced.
